Observations: Studies in New Zealand Documentary by Russell Campbell
ISBN: 9780864736567 PUBLISHER: Victoria University Press FORMAT: Paperback PAGES: 260 PUBLICATION DATE: 30.09.2011 DIMENSIONS: 210mmX146mmX23mm 440grams
DESCRIPTION: In recent times New Zealanders have engaged in battle over who we are and what we would like our country to be, and documentary film has been in the thick of it. From the picket lines of industrial conflict to the occupied ground of Maori land rights campaigns, from the stormy skirmishes of women's liberation to disputed histories of the New Zealand Wars or the New Right revolution a century later, the filmmakers have been there, documenting the action and deliberately or inadvertently helping forge a sense of national identity. They have been there, too, chronicling the work of our artists and poets, our musicians and Kiwiana exponents, as they struggle to express the meaning of a life in Aotearoa. Observations is a series of dispatches from the front, commentaries on the fray from an admittedly partisan reporter who is both critic and filmmaker himself.
